St. Vincent‘s Annie Clark is gearing up for her forthcoming album Daddy’s Home, the follow-up to 2017’s MASSEDUCTION. She’s already released the first two singles that nod to a glamorously grimy New York state of mind. This past weekend on Saturday Night Live, she performed both “Pay Your Way in Pain” and “The Melting of the Sun” with a four-piece band and three fabulous back-up singers.

Who are these glorious ladies draped in plum jumpsuits? Their names are Sy Smith, Neka, and Nayanna Holley. Alongside Clark, whether in a key lime green pantsuit or a pink and silver sequined slip dress, the group of gals had mesmerizing chemistry.
